Hi all. I am in the process of weaning myself off of 5/325 percoset. I have 2 weeks to do it. Currently I am on 2 pills (cut in half/spread over 4 doses) per day. My pharmacist told me not to go ct. So, my question is, how low of a dose can I go before I actually stop altogether wo withdrawal? I've already cut down from 60mg day to 10, and everytime I lower the dose, I do experience symptoms, but nothing intollerable. Thanks for any input.

You are most of the way there.
you have enough to cut down by 1/2 mg each day which would put you at about 3mg on your last day.
by that time you shouldnt experience any bad w/d

The one thing to be aware of is depression after stopping.it can take a while for your body to adjust but you will feel better each day.If you taper for the next 2 weeks you should be fine when its time to stop.

If you are taking (2) 5/325 pills and cutting them in half which allows you to take a half a pill 4 times a day just slowly taper down to 3 times a day then 2 times a day, then one and your done. You are by no means taking a very large dose in my opinion if you are taking only 2 5/325 pills daily. That is 10 mgs of Hydocodone and a lot of tylenol each day. Tapering off should be real straight forward and easy to accomplish. I take it you are feeling better and don't need the medicine as you are attempting in discontinuing it and the constant useage of the 325 mgs of acetophetamin(tylenol) per dose I hear is not good for real long periods of time, as your internal organs (liver & Kidney's) have to filter all of the acetophetamin. I am so glad that you are able to not need the medicine. It is always advisable to check with your physician prior to discontinuing any medication but I just don't really forsee you having a problem if you ween your self off of this small amount of medicine over a short period of time and then just quit taking it if it is not necessary. Surely after cutting back you body will never miss that small of a dose. What you are taking is about the least strongest medicine and it should be relatively easy to discontinue it's use.
